Comparison Summary for Betaine and Niacin?
When it comes to choosing between betaine and niacin, it's essential to understand their roles in the body and how they compare to each other.
### Betaine's Role in the Body
Betaine, also known as trimethylglycine, is a naturally occurring compound found in various foods, including beets, spinach, and shellfish. It plays a crucial role in the body's methylation process, which is essential for DNA synthesis, gene expression, and detoxification. Betaine has also been shown to have anti-inflammatory properties and may help improve liver function.
### Niacin's Role in the Body
Niacin, also known as vitamin B3, is an essential nutrient that plays a vital role in energy metabolism and maintaining healthy skin, nerves, and digestive system. It's also involved in the synthesis of cholesterol and fatty acids. Niacin has been shown to have several health benefits, including improving cholesterol profiles, reducing inflammation, and even helping with weight loss.
### Betaine vs Niacin: Key Differences
While both betaine and niacin are involved in energy metabolism, they have distinct differences in their roles and functions. Betaine is primarily involved in the methylation process, whereas niacin is more focused on energy metabolism and cholesterol synthesis.
